The Long-Term Implications of AI-Powered Automation

The advance of AI automation brings several significant implications. Firstly, it prompts a redefinition of job roles as automation takes over repetitive tasks, potentially improving efficiency and accuracy. Secondly, AI-triggered changes can lead to wider skill gaps, requiring ongoing training and education to embrace new technologies. Finally, AI adoption across industries can create new business opportunities while simultaneously presenting new ethical and regulatory challenges.

Actionable Advice

Businesses must prepare for these developments by adopting a proactive and strategic approach towards AI-centered decisions. We’ve identified several key steps:

  1. Embracing continuous learning: Workforces need to anticipate the ongoing shift in skill requirements and promote a culture of lifelong learning.
  2. Focusing on AI ethics: Companies should consider creating a dedicated AI ethics board and investing in technology that promotes transparency and responsibility.
  3. Exploiting AI opportunities: Look for new and exciting prospects that AI-powered automation can offer.
  4. Future-proofing your business: Develop robust strategies to future-proof your business in the face of rapid AI development.
